Quick Assessment
This book introduces early readers to the basics of note writing through clear examples and simple instructions. Designed for children ages 5 to 8, it supports literacy development and encourages communication skills in a friendly, accessible way. The content is gentle and appropriate, focusing on practical learning without any challenging themes.
